“It is our failure to become our perceived ideal that ultimately defines us and makes us unique. It’s not easy, but if you accept your misfortune and handle it right, your perceived failure can be a catalyst for profound re-invention. So, at the age of 47, after 25 years of obsessively pursuing my dream, that dream changed. For decades in show business the ultimate goal of every comedian was to host The Tonight Show: it was the holy grail. And like many people, I thought that achieving that goal would define me as successful. But that is not true. No specific job or career goal defines me, nor should it define you. In 2000, I told graduates not to be afraid to fail and I still believe that. But today I tell you whether you fear it or not, disappoint will come. The beauty is that through disappointment you can gain clarity and with clarity, comes conviction and true originality.” - Conan O’Brien, 2011 Dartmouth College Commencement Address
